Core components that define the best boat repair kits for fiberglass
When assessing the best boat repair kits for fiberglass, start with the resin technology. High grade epoxy resin or polyester fiberglass resin must be paired with the correct resin hardener ratio, because an imprecise system leads to weak repairs and future cracks. Premium marine kits clearly label mix ratios, pot life, and cure times so a skipper can plan work around tides and weather windows.
Look for a repair kit that includes woven fiberglass cloth, chopped strand mat, and a small selection of fillers for resin repair. These items allow you to address both structural holes in a hull and cosmetic nicks on a gel coat surface. A complete kit for kit boats or larger yachts should also contain mixing pots, spreaders, gloves, and abrasive papers so you are not hunting for missing tools while the boat moves at anchor.
Gelcoat repair capability separates basic boat repair packs from truly marine grade repair kits. The best systems include gel coat pastes, tints for accurate color match, and clear instructions for gelcoat repair over marine fiberglass laminates. When you evaluate the price of any product, factor in whether the system epoxy, gel components, and patch kit accessories will handle several repairs across multiple boats in your fleet.

Seasonal care strategy: when and where to use fiberglass repair kits
Seasonal care for a fiberglass boat starts the moment you haul out. As soon as the hull dries, inspect for small cracks, star crazing, and impact marks around the waterline and near the keel where groundings occur. The best boat repair kits for fiberglass let you stabilise these areas before you move on to antifouling and topside cosmetics.
During spring refit, use a structured system for inspection and boat repair that moves from bow to stern and then from deck to underwater hull. Mark every area needing fiberglass repair with tape, then decide whether a quick patch kit is sufficient or whether a deeper resin repair with fiberglass cloth and multiple laminate layers is required. This disciplined approach ensures no marine fiberglass damage hides beneath a fresh gel coat or antifouling paint.
Once structural work is complete, apply gel coat touch ups before any underwater paint, especially if you plan to use a high performance marine antifouling paint system. Properly cured fiberglass resin and gel coat repairs provide a stable base for coatings, reducing the risk of future blisters or peeling. In autumn, repeat the inspection cycle, using your repair kits to close small voids and surface defects in high wear zones so winter moisture cannot penetrate the laminate.
Choosing between epoxy, polyester, and gel coat systems for yachts
Yacht passionate owners often ask whether epoxy resin or polyester fiberglass resin is better for hull repairs. Epoxy based repair kits usually deliver higher bond strength and better adhesion to older fiberglass boat laminates, which makes them ideal for structural cracks and reinforcement work. Polyester systems, by contrast, remain common for original production because they cure quickly and align with many factory gel coat formulations.
For the best boat repair kits for fiberglass, a hybrid strategy works well on many boats. Use an epoxy resin repair system with compatible system epoxy hardeners and fiberglass cloth for deep repairs, then finish with a polyester based gel coat or dedicated gelcoat repair product for surface color match. This layered approach respects the mechanical strengths of epoxy while preserving the visual continuity of the original gel coat.

On board storage, safety, and practical use of repair kits at sea
Carrying a compact fiberglass repair kit on board is as critical as flares or spare filters. Offshore, even small cracks or punctures from floating debris can escalate quickly if water reaches core materials or structural frames. A well organised set of repair kits allows you to stabilise damage until a yard can complete permanent repairs.
Store resin, resin hardener, and gel coat components in a cool, dry locker away from direct heat sources and living spaces. Many marine products release fumes during curing, so plan boat repair tasks with ventilation in mind and always use gloves, masks, and eye protection from the kit items. Label each product clearly, especially system epoxy bottles, to avoid mixing incompatible brands or incorrect ratios during a stressful situation.
Practice using your patch kit on scrap fiberglass cloth and offcuts before an emergency arises. This rehearsal builds confidence with mixing epoxy resin, applying fiberglass resin layers, and fairing gelcoat repair surfaces to an acceptable finish. Integrating fiberglass repair into a broader seasonal maintenance plan
Effective seasonal care treats fiberglass repair as one element of a wider maintenance matrix. Schedule hull inspections, surface restoration tasks, and gel coat polishing alongside engine servicing, rig checks, and safety gear reviews to create a coherent annual rhythm. This structured approach mirrors professional yacht programmes where every system, from resin based structures to electronics, receives attention on a fixed calendar.
Start with a written checklist that covers underwater hull, topsides, deck, and interior structural zones where marine fiberglass is exposed. For each area, note whether you need a quick patch kit, a full boat repair kit with fiberglass cloth and epoxy resin, or a specialist gelcoat repair product for cosmetic color match. Over several seasons, these records reveal patterns of recurring cracks, chips, or localised impact damage, guiding you toward more permanent structural upgrades.
